Overview of Metal Casting Strategies
Metal casting methods incorporate a range of methods utilized to form liquified metal into desired types. These strategies are necessary in numerous markets, including automobile, aerospace, and art, enabling the manufacturing of components with intricate information and complex geometries. The key procedures consist of gravity spreading, where steel flows into a mold under its weight, and stress casting, where molten steel is pushed into a mold tooth cavity. Financial investment spreading, known for its precision, utilizes a wax pattern that is disappeared, creating a very accurate mold and mildew. Pass away casting uses a high-pressure system to generate parts quickly, while shed foam spreading incorporates the efficiency of foam patterns with precision. Each strategy has its benefits, customized to details applications based upon variables like product residential properties, manufacturing volume, and preferred surface. Comprehending these methods allows suppliers to select one of the most ideal approach for their unique requirements, optimizing both performance and top quality in steel production.
Sand Spreading: The Most Usual Method
Numerous spreading approaches exist, sand spreading continues to be the most common method in the sector due to its adaptability and cost-effectiveness. This technique employs sand as a main mold and mildew material, enabling the creation of complicated forms and big parts. The procedure begins with the formation of a mold and mildew, usually made from a mixture of sand and a binding agent. When the mold and mildew is ready, molten metal is put right into the tooth cavity, filling up every detail of the layout.
After the steel solidifies and cools down, the mold is broken away to disclose the final casting. Sand casting is specifically favored for its capacity to accommodate a large range of steels, including iron, steel, and light weight aluminum. In addition, it appropriates for both small-scale production and big quantities, making it a perfect selection for markets such as auto, aerospace, and building and construction. Metal Casting. Its simplicity and effectiveness remain to drive its appeal in metalworking

Process Review
When precision and elaborate detail are critical, investment spreading becomes a recommended approach in metalworking. Metal Foundry. This procedure begins with creating a wax or polymer pattern, which is after that coated with a ceramic covering. Once the shell sets, the pattern is melted out, leaving a mold. Molten steel is put right into this mold to produce the desired form. After cooling, the ceramic shell is gotten rid of, exposing the cast part. Investment spreading permits intricate geometries and limited tolerances, making it ideal for numerous materials, consisting of titanium, aluminum, and steel. This method is especially valued in sectors that need complex designs and top notch finishes, making sure that each cast component meets rigid specifications with minimal post-processing

Die Spreading: High-Volume Production
Pass away casting emerges as a significant approach for high-volume manufacturing, particularly in industries needing precision-engineered components. This technique involves requiring molten steel under high pressure right into a mold tooth cavity, causing get rid of superb dimensional precision and surface area finish. Typically used with non-ferrous steels such as light weight aluminum, zinc, and magnesium, die spreading is favored for its ability to create intricate shapes with very little machining needs.
The procedure enables quick manufacturing cycles, making it excellent for manufacturing huge quantities of parts effectively. Die casting is extensively employed in automotive, aerospace, and customer electronics markets, where dependability and repeatability are necessary. Additionally, developments in modern technology have actually led to improved mold and mildew designs and materials, improving check here the resilience and life-span of the molds. Overall, pass away spreading attracts attention as an important method for producers aiming to meet high production demands while keeping high quality and cost-effectiveness in their operations.

History of Lost Wax
Among the myriad metal casting methods, shed wax casting attracts attention for its special artistic expression and rich historical origins. This technique, thought to day back over 5,000 years, has actually been used by various people, consisting of the ancient Egyptians, Greeks, and Chinese. Used for creating complex precious jewelry and ceremonial objects, lost wax spreading allowed artisans to duplicate in-depth designs with accuracy. The process entails sculpting a model in wax, which is then enclosed in a mold. As soon as heated up, the wax melts away, leaving a tooth cavity for molten metal. This technique not only showcases the ability of the musician but additionally highlights the social value of metalwork throughout background, affecting contemporary practices in sculpture and design.
Refine Steps Clarified
The intricate process of shed wax casting entails several meticulously orchestrated actions that change a wax model right into a stunning metal artefact. Originally, an artist develops a detailed wax design, which serves as the template for the final piece. This design is after that covered with a refractory material to form a mold and mildew, adhered to by heating up to allow the wax to melt and drain away, leaving a hollow tooth cavity. Next, molten metal is put right into the mold and mildew, loading deep space left by the wax. As soon as the steel cools down and solidifies, the mold is escaped to disclose the finished item. Any necessary finishing touches, such as polishing and surface area treatment, are used to enhance the piece's visual allure and toughness.
Applications of Steel Casting in Various Industries
Steel spreading offers as a fundamental procedure across countless markets, offering crucial elements for a large variety of applications. In the automotive industry, it allows the manufacturing of engine blocks, transmission cases, and various structural parts, adding to automobile toughness and efficiency. The aerospace market makes use of steel casting for light-weight yet strong elements, such as wind turbine blades and landing equipment, vital for trip security.

In construction, cast metal components like installations and light beams boost architectural stability and visual charm. The power industry also benefits, with actors parts made use of in turbines and generators, optimizing performance in power manufacturing. In addition, the clinical field uses steel spreading to create accuracy tools and implants, highlighting its function ahead of time medical care technology. On the whole, steel casting's versatility and performance make it important for creating high-grade parts across varied markets, driving technology and meeting specific functional requirements.
